is a psychological horror game that leans heavily into the "creepypasta" aesthetic, subverting the childhood nostalgia of Kung Fu Panda into a disturbing, glitch-filled experience. While it follows the familiar "haunted game file" trope, it manages to create a genuine sense of unease through its sound design and visual distortion.
